        <description>Foie gras is one of the cruelest foods in animal agriculture today. A so-called delicacy at many upscale restaurants, many Americans don't know it's made from the diseased livers of force-fed ducks and geese and causes the suffering of 500,000 birds each year. And even though it's considered widely unacceptable, it's still legal in 49 out of 50 states. Because of this, Animal Equality is working strategically state by state in the US towards a nationwide ban. Animal Equality's President and Co-Founder Sharon Núñez sat down with our legal expert Sarah Hanneken to discuss our investigative work on foie gras farms and what can be done legally to stop the practice of force-feeding. Together, they answer vital questions on how animal advocates like you can help animals both locally and nationally.
